Forged pipe fittings made from 1.4307 stainless steel

1. Definition

Forged pipe fittings made from 1.4307 stainless steel (also known as AISI 304L) are components used to connect, redirect, or terminate piping systems. They are known for their corrosion resistance and durability.

2. Materials

1.4307 (AISI 304L) is a low-carbon version of 304 stainless steel, providing excellent corrosion resistance, good weldability, and improved resistance to pitting.

3. Manufacturing Process

  • Forging: The process involves heating the stainless steel to a malleable state and shaping it under high pressure. This enhances its mechanical properties.

  • Heat Treatment: Typically, heat treatment is not required for 1.4307 due to its low carbon content, but it may be annealed to relieve stresses and improve corrosion resistance.

4. Applications

Forged fittings made from 1.4307 stainless steel are commonly used in:

  • Chemical Processing: For piping systems that handle corrosive substances.

  • Food and Beverage Industry: In applications requiring high sanitary standards.

  • Oil and Gas: For connecting pipes in various applications where durability is crucial.

5. Advantages

  • Corrosion Resistance: Excellent performance in aggressive environments.

  • Strength and Durability: Forged components are generally stronger than cast products.

  • Versatility: Suitable for various applications due to their mechanical properties and resistance to temperature variations.
